Doris Adeline Hook, 96, of Independence, MO, passed away on Thursday, January 22, 2026 at her home. She was born on February 14, 1929 in Stratton, NE to William Claude and Louise May (Price) Hartman. In 1937, they moved to Iowa and then later to Bethany, MO. She graduated from Bethany High School in 1946. And then on June 28, 1946, she was united in marriage to Paul L. Hook of Martinsville, MO. Together they had three children and celebrated 62 years together before Paul's passing on January 22, 2009.
In November 1956, Doris united with the Sweet Springs Christian Church in Sweet Springs, MO and later changed her membership to the First United Methodist Church of Independence, MO after moving there in 1960. She was a member of the Mizpah Sunday School class, the Good Samaritan Circle, and chairman of the library committee. She was a volunteer at the Independence Regional Hospital for 12 years and Cler-Mont Elementary School with Caring Communities for 10 years.
